Transaction 03ba67a041d46af6470ae34b93df685954ec33c685f4f9603c707693efcf8045
1 Input
1 Output
-
03ba67a041d46af6470ae34b93df685954ec33c685f4f9603c707693efcf8045:0
- value
- 9317490
- script pubkey
- OP_0 OP_PUSHBYTES_20 864b10d36e5f84a8d0decf7ea8b71cb7784dca7b
- address
- bc1qse93p5mwt7z235x7eal23dcukauymjnmhr8cz6